Hi, I recently open a claim for an item that I received that was not as described. PayPal have sided with the seller saying I could have damaged the item (which I haven’t or would never do) I’m now out of pocket with an item I can’t wear is their anything else I can do? as I think this is completely unfair and would appreciate any help or advice you can offer.

Unfortunately disputes are often down to a judgement call as payal never see the actual item, sometimes you lose out and sometimes the seller.
Thats the risk of online sales unfortunately.
However just because paypal didn't find in your favour it doesn't stop you from doing a chargeback if you funded your paypal payment via a credit card OR the small claims court if you have enough proof?
